Ukraine-US Peace Talks: Florida Meetings Lead to Continuation in Davos

Ukrainian delegation met US officials in Florida to discuss security guarantees and economic recovery, agreeing to continue negotiations at the World Economic Forum in Davos, January 19-23, 2026.

Why It Matters

These talks represent a key diplomatic effort toward a potential peace deal in the Russia-Ukraine war, involving security guarantees and post-war reconstruction amid high-level US involvement under President Trump.

Timeline

5 Events

World Economic Forum scheduled in Davos

January 19, 2026

Talks set to continue on sidelines of WEF Annual Meeting in Davos, Switzerland, with potential high-level participation including Trump and Zelensky; Ukraine House Davos events planned on peace and reconstruction.

Umerov announces agreement to continue talks in Davos

January 18, 2026

Rustem Umerov states on social media that delegations agreed to hold additional talks in Davos on security guarantees and economic development during the World Economic Forum.

US-Ukraine talks held in Florida

January 17, 2026

Over two days in Florida, Ukrainian officials meet US representatives including Steve Witkoff, Jared Kushner, Daniel Driscoll, and Josh Gruenbaum to discuss security guarantees and economic prosperity plan.

Ukrainian delegation arrives in US for Miami talks

January 17, 2026

Delegation including Rustem Umerov, Kyrylo Budanov, and Davyd Arakhamia arrives in the US for discussions in Miami on security guarantees and post-war recovery with US representatives.

Zelensky announces delegation to US

January 16, 2026

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ky announces delegation traveling to the US for talks on peace agreement details, security guarantees, and Russia's response, hoping for signing in Davos.
